Cognitive Ability
The capacity of an individual to perform various mental activities related to learning, problem-solving, decision-making, and similar intellectual functions.
Selling Process
A structured approach to selling that involves identifying prospects, presenting products, overcoming objections, and closing sales, aimed at converting leads into customers.
Tangible Attributes
Physical features or characteristics of a product that can be sensed directly, such as size, design, or color.
Reputation
The general belief or opinion that the public has about the character, quality, or credibility of a person, company, or product.
